Tables and chairs were thrown during a fight outside a pub in Glasgow.

A large group of men were walking along Hope Street when a brawl broke out between them and three other men.

Two of the men had come out of the Toby Jug pub shortly before the incident around 3.50pm on Sunday.

Some of the men picked up tables and chairs from the outdoor seating area and began hurling them at the pub.

Police are now appealing for anything who witnessed the fight or who has any information to contact them.

Detective Sergeant Euan Keil, from Greater Glasgow CID, said: "There appears to have been an exchange of words between a couple of patrons from the Toby Jug pub and a group of men who had been walking north on Hope Street, which then resulted in a large-scale disturbance with some tables and chairs being thrown about.

"So far we have not had any reports of people being injured during this incident, however, it was the middle of the afternoon and there were lots of people and cars about and we cannot have this type of behaviour happening anywhere never mind in the middle of a busy city centre.

"Officers are currently reviewing CCTV and social media videos showing the fight to try and identify those involved, however we would also appeal to anyone who has information that will assist our enquiries to contact Greater Glasgow CID via 101 quoting reference number 2524 of the 31 March 2019."
